School Librarian/School Library Media Specialist is the 741st most popular major in the country with 330 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.
Across Alabama, there were 2 school librarian/school library media specialist gra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 2 school librarian/school library media specialist graduates with average earnings and debt of $54,487 and $41,507 respectively.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of South Alabama. It ranked #1 on our 2022 Best Value School Librarian/School Library Media Specialist Schools for a Master’s in Alabama list. USA is a fairly large public school situated in Mobile, Alabama. It awarded 2 masters’s school librarian/school library media specialist degrees in 2019-2020.
In addition to being on our alabama master’s degree school librarian/school library media specialist students list, USA has also earned the #1 rank in our “Best School Librarian/School Library Media Specialist Master’s Degree Schools in Alabama” ranking. Average graduate tuition and fees at University of South Alabama are $16,112,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.
